Assessing activity in the psychiatric sector is a contemporary issue, and it is rendered even more complex by the variety of pathologies and the diversity of the existing organisational structures of care. Data collection has been taking place for more than 15 years, but is insufficiently utilised. The Department of Medical Information attempted to analyse a typology of patients’ options of courses to care. This analysis demonstrates that the elements for forecasting the amount and level of care provided are not linked as much to the pathology being treated, as they are to the organisation of the range of services which take care of the management and delivery of the care.
